Compartir a través de


PrivateEndpoint Constructores

Definición

Sobrecargas

PrivateEndpoint()

Inicializa una nueva instancia de la clase PrivateEndpoint.

PrivateEndpoint(String, String, String, String, IDictionary<String, String>, ExtendedLocation, Subnet, IList<NetworkInterface>, String, IList<PrivateLinkServiceConnection>, IList<PrivateLinkServiceConnection>, IList<CustomDnsConfigPropertiesFormat>, IList<ApplicationSecurityGroup>, IList<PrivateEndpointIPConfiguration>, String, String)

Inicializa una nueva instancia de la clase PrivateEndpoint.

PrivateEndpoint()

Inicializa una nueva instancia de la clase PrivateEndpoint.

public PrivateEndpoint ();
Public Sub New ()

Se aplica a

PrivateEndpoint(String, String, String, String, IDictionary<String, String>, ExtendedLocation, Subnet, IList<NetworkInterface>, String, IList<PrivateLinkServiceConnection>, IList<PrivateLinkServiceConnection>, IList<CustomDnsConfigPropertiesFormat>, IList<ApplicationSecurityGroup>, IList<PrivateEndpointIPConfiguration>, String, String)

Inicializa una nueva instancia de la clase PrivateEndpoint.

public PrivateEndpoint (string id = default, string name = default, string type = default, string location = default, System.Collections.Generic.IDictionary<string,string> tags = default, Microsoft.Azure.Management.Network.Models.ExtendedLocation extendedLocation = default, Microsoft.Azure.Management.Network.Models.Subnet subnet = default, System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.NetworkInterface> networkInterfaces = default, string provisioningState = default, System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.PrivateLinkServiceConnection> privateLinkServiceConnections = default, System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.PrivateLinkServiceConnection> manualPrivateLinkServiceConnections = default, System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.CustomDnsConfigPropertiesFormat> customDnsConfigs = default, System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.ApplicationSecurityGroup> applicationSecurityGroups = default, System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.PrivateEndpointIPConfiguration> ipConfigurations = default, string customNetworkInterfaceName = default, string etag = default);
new Microsoft.Azure.Management.Network.Models.PrivateEndpoint : string * string * string * string * System.Collections.Generic.IDictionary<string, string> * Microsoft.Azure.Management.Network.Models.ExtendedLocation * Microsoft.Azure.Management.Network.Models.Subnet * System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.NetworkInterface> * string * System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.PrivateLinkServiceConnection> * System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.PrivateLinkServiceConnection> * System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.CustomDnsConfigPropertiesFormat> * System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.ApplicationSecurityGroup> * System.Collections.Generic.IList<Microsoft.Azure.Management.Network.Models.PrivateEndpointIPConfiguration> * string * string -> Microsoft.Azure.Management.Network.Models.PrivateEndpoint
Public Sub New (Optional id As String = Nothing, Optional name As String = Nothing, Optional type As String = Nothing, Optional location As String = Nothing, Optional tags As IDictionary(Of String, String) = Nothing, Optional extendedLocation As ExtendedLocation = Nothing, Optional subnet As Subnet = Nothing, Optional networkInterfaces As IList(Of NetworkInterface) = Nothing, Optional provisioningState As String = Nothing, Optional privateLinkServiceConnections As IList(Of PrivateLinkServiceConnection) = Nothing, Optional manualPrivateLinkServiceConnections As IList(Of PrivateLinkServiceConnection) = Nothing, Optional customDnsConfigs As IList(Of CustomDnsConfigPropertiesFormat) = Nothing, Optional applicationSecurityGroups As IList(Of ApplicationSecurityGroup) = Nothing, Optional ipConfigurations As IList(Of PrivateEndpointIPConfiguration) = Nothing, Optional customNetworkInterfaceName As String = Nothing, Optional etag As String = Nothing)

Parámetros

id
String

Identificador del recurso.

name
String

Nombre del recurso.

type
String

Tipo de recurso.

location
String

Ubicación del recurso

tags
IDictionary<String,String>

Etiquetas del recurso.

extendedLocation
ExtendedLocation

Ubicación extendida del equilibrador de carga.

subnet
Subnet

Identificador de la subred desde la que se asignará la dirección IP privada.

networkInterfaces
IList<NetworkInterface>

Matriz de referencias a las interfaces de red creadas para este punto de conexión privado.

provisioningState
String

Estado de aprovisionamiento del recurso de punto de conexión privado. Entre los valores posibles se incluyen: "Succeeded", "Updating", "Deleting", "Failed"

privateLinkServiceConnections
IList<PrivateLinkServiceConnection>

Agrupación de información sobre la conexión al recurso remoto.

manualPrivateLinkServiceConnections
IList<PrivateLinkServiceConnection>

Agrupación de información sobre la conexión al recurso remoto. Se usa cuando el administrador de red no tiene acceso para aprobar las conexiones al recurso remoto.

customDnsConfigs
IList<CustomDnsConfigPropertiesFormat>

Matriz de configuraciones dns personalizadas.

applicationSecurityGroups
IList<ApplicationSecurityGroup>

Grupos de seguridad de aplicaciones en los que se incluye la configuración ip del punto de conexión privado.

ipConfigurations
IList<PrivateEndpointIPConfiguration>

Lista de configuraciones de IP del punto de conexión privado. Se usará para asignarlos a los puntos de conexión del servicio de primera entidad.

customNetworkInterfaceName
String

Nombre personalizado de la interfaz de red asociada al punto de conexión privado.

etag
String

Cadena de solo lectura única que cambia cada vez que se actualiza el recurso.

Se aplica a